Project Manager - Frome, Somerset Our client is an established and respected general Civil Engineering sub-contractor operating across UK and Europe. Their division undertakes large civil engineering packages on behalf of Tier-1 main contractors primarily involved in the civil, data centre, infrastructure, utilities, turnkey solutions, preconstruction service, mechanical, electrical. The project: Heavy civils and steel frame/ clad project in Frome, Somerset, Duration approximately 12 months , Value £20m + As a Project Manager, you will be responsible in ensuring our major projects are completed on time and within budget, the project objectives are met in line with the company standards. You will be responsible for setting, maintaining, and leading the project organisation. You will oversee the project to ensure the desired result is achieved, the most efficient resources are used, and the stakeholders involved are satisfied Key Role Deliverables
  • Delivery of major projects to programme, budget, HSEQ, client and contract requirements
  • Agreeing the timescales, costs and resources needed to deliver the project
  • Selecting, maintaining, and leading a project team
  • Negotiating with contractors and suppliers for materials and services
  • Reporting regularly on progress to the client
  • Maintaining effective communication with stakeholders
  • Resolving any issues/ delays which may occur
  • Communicating with clients, contractors, colleagues, and suppliers on the progress of a project
  • Demonstrating knowledge of all areas of construction
  • Managing your site-based team and liaising with support services
  • Managing the project commercially, including owning the budget, allocating resources to manage it, and reporting to the project director
  • Any other reasonable requests as required by the needs of the business.
  • It is expected that all of your behaviours and day to day activities will be underpinned by the company core values Minimum Qualifications and Experience
  • Degree qualified
  • Previous working experience as a Project Manager
  • Previous experience in earthworks and reinforced concrete works
  • Proven experience managing operational and commercial aspects of projects
  • Strong organisational, leadership and management skills
  • Proven technical and project management skills
  • Knowledge of the requirements and implementation of CDM regulations
  • Detailed knowledge of Safety, Quality and Environmental issues relevant to the project environment What you can expect in return
  • Competitive base salary
  • Company car or car allowance
  • Discretionary bonus scheme
  • 24 days holiday plus bank holidays, increasing with length of service
  • Holiday purchase scheme
  • Paid charity day
  • Pension
  • Monthly socials
  • Due to the location of this project can consider either locally based candidates or candidates that are willing to stay in the project location during the week. For those considering staying locally we can support with subsistence as laid out in the CIJC scheme
